Benefits of Walnut Tree Pruning Service

1. Promotes Tree Health: Regular pruning of walnut trees helps improve their overall health and vitality. By removing dead or diseased branches, the tree can focus its energy on new growth and fruit production.

2. Enhances Fruit Quality: Pruning allows for better air circulation and sunlight penetration through the canopy, resulting in improved fruit quality. It also helps in reducing the risk of pest and disease infestations.

3. Increases Yield: Proper pruning techniques stimulate the growth of lateral branches, which are responsible for bearing fruit. By removing unwanted branches, the tree can direct its resources towards producing a higher yield of healthy and abundant walnuts.

4. Shapes Tree Structure: Pruning helps in shaping the tree's structure, ensuring it grows in a desirable form. This not only enhances the aesthetic appeal of the tree but also reduces the risk of branches breaking or falling during storms or high winds.

5. Prevents Hazards: Regular pruning eliminates weak or overgrown branches that could pose a safety risk to people or property. By removing these potential hazards, the tree becomes safer and more secure.

Questions and Answers about Walnut Tree Pruning Service:

Q: When is the best time to prune walnut trees?

A: Walnut trees are typically pruned during late winter or early spring, while they are still dormant. This allows for optimal healing and reduces the risk of disease transmission.

Q: Can I prune my walnut tree myself, or should I hire a professional?

A: While minor pruning can be done by homeowners, it is recommended to hire a professional for larger pruning tasks. They have the expertise and knowledge to ensure proper techniques are used, minimizing the risk of damage to the tree.

Q: How often should walnut trees be pruned?

A: Walnut trees should be pruned on a regular basis, ideally every 2-3 years. However, the frequency may vary depending on the tree's size, age, and overall health. Consulting with an arborist can help determine the best pruning schedule for your specific walnut tree.
